>This is the entire universe of possibilities (assuming integer ages)
>
>
>a      1       1     225
>b      1       3      75
>c      1       5      45
>d      1       9      25
>e      1      15      15
>f      3       3      25
>g      3       5      15
>h      5       5       9
>
>
>a can be eliminated because 225 is an impossible age to attain. e g and h can be eliminated because the oldest person is not of legal age to own a home. f could be eliminated because it sums to the same value as e. But I don't see any way to eliminate down to only one of the remaining b, c and d candidate solutions.

They key to moving further ahead is that the cenus taker must ask another question to determine the ages. He already knows the house number (the sum), so he should be able to get the ages, but he can't.
